JOB DESCRIPTION

The Engineering Test Engineer II is responsible for conducting product testing and providing support to all levels of engineering in product design & Verification activities. This support includes development and custom fabrication of specialized electromechanical test fixtures and tooling capable of producing reliable, accurate, and repeatable results to underscore design validation and the assurance of quality and safety across the entire range of Resideo products.

JOB DUTIES:


  • Conduct tests of new components, assemblies and systems based on established test criteria, policies and procedures or written test plans.
  • Conduct various performance tests on company products and/or comparison tests of competitive products and components in accordance with test criteria established by policies and procedures or written test plans.
  • Maintain accurate records of test results, including the identification and reporting of any deviations or anomalies observed during the testing. Report results to appropriate cross-functional teams, including development, quality assurance, and testing personnel.
  • Demonstrate a strong commitment to continuous improvement by proactively seeking means to optimize testing processes and enhance testing efficiency when and where possible.
  • Prepare prototypes of components assemblies and systems of either new or current products as directed by policies and procedures or written test plans or work requests. Ensures that the prototypes meet the established specifications.
  • Safely operates required machinery and equipment following established safety rules, maintain a clean and organized work area, adhere to established tool and instrument control procedures, and report any unsafe acts or conditions to his or her immediate supervisor.
  • Perform inspections and installations of parts and components on test carts. Maintain accurate records of the installation of these parts and the timely collection of test data.

ABOUT US

Resideo is a leading global provider of critical comfort and security solutions primarily in residential environments and distributor of low-voltage electronic and security products. Building on a 130-year heritage, Resideo has a presence in more than 150 million homes, with 15 million systems installed in homes each year. We continue to serve more than 110,000 professionals through leading distributors, including our ADI Global Distribution business, which exports to more than 100 countries from more than 200 stocking locations around the world. Resideo is a $5.0 billion company with approximately 13,000 global employees. For more information about Resideo, please visit www.resideo.com.
